According to reports, Newcastle is now considering a move for Samu Aghehowa, a 21-year-old striker from FC Porto. Aghehowa scored 27 goals and provided three assists for Porto last season. He signed a five-year deal with Porto for €15m and has a €100m release clause.
Newcastle would be willing to pay the release clause to sign Aghehowa, as they need a replacement for Isak. Isak is currently training alone and wants to join Liverpool, but his deal is conditional on Newcastle signing a new striker. The club is struggling to find a suitable replacement, and Isak is stuck away from the squad as the season approaches.
